#6334cf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#6334cf is composed of 38.8% red, 20.4% green and 81.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 52.2% cyan, 74.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 18.8% black. It has a hue angle of 258.2 degrees, a saturation of 61.8% and a lightness of 50.8%. #6334cf color hex could be obtained by blending #c668ff with #00009f. Closest websafe color is: #6633cc.

#6334cf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#6334cf has RGB values of R:99, G:52, B:207 and CMYK values of C:0.52, M:0.75, Y:0, K:0.19. Its decimal value is 6501583.
